Artist Bios:
Phoebe Murphy is a Chinese-American writer of literary and speculative fiction. Born in China and raised in Houston, Texas, she is an MFA candidate at Texas State University. Her work has been featured in Nocturne Magazine and Chthonic Matter, and she is currently at work on a novel.
As guest rooms, Persian-Texan Mason Parva explores the possibility of paradox. Classic songcraft coexists with ambient textures and field recordings to create a sound that is at once intimate and vast, reverent and irreverent, familiar and otherworldly. Lyrically, Parva explores themes of love, creation, myth, truth, and ultimate reality. Each song is a quiet portal into the self, inviting one to look directly at their parts that contradict yet harmonize.
Albeit the Maze, also known as June Nguyen, is a transfeminine Vietnamese American singer-songwriter based in Austin, Texas. Pulling from musical inspirations such as Radiohead, Fleet Foxes, St. Vincent, and The National, June writes acoustic-forward songs that aim to impart a sense of longing. Her debut release, Victim of a Threat EP, explores topics such as masculinity, loneliness, repression, and abandonment through the lens of a trans woman born and raised in Texas by Catholic immigrant parents.
